Salve Salve! Bom hoje vou falar um pouco sobre o exame 310-055 e aqueles que pretendem ser Sun Certified Programmer Java – SCJP vai algumas dicas. O que vai conter aqui é apenas minha experiência que tive com essa certificação em minha jornada de 14 meses de estudo.
As informações sobre o exame 310-055 encontram-se: Site da Sun
Livros Recomendados:
– Guia Certificação Java – Exame 310-055 – Kathy Sierra
– Certificação Java 5 – Roberto Rubinstein
Obs.: Ambos disponível em portugues
Como fazer o exame?
Para fazer o exame é simples basta ligar para Sun 0800-55-7863 e solicitar o voucher* e informar qual exame deseja: SCJP, SCWCD, SCJA etc. Após a solicitação em até 2 à 3 dias úteis você recebe um e-mail para efetuar o pagamento em boleto do voucher que custa R$ 330,00 (no Brasil). Após a confirmação de pagamento a Sun envia o voucher para o endereço informado na solicitação em até 20 dias.
*Voucher – é um passaporte que você vai usar para marcar sua prova.
Validade: Você tem até um ano para fazer a prova.
Marcando o exame: após ter estudado bastante é hora de marcar a prova, e o processo é feito apenas on-line. O candidato deve marcar o exame de 10 a 15 dias antes da data que pretende fazer. Pois caso seja necessario cancelar o exame somente é possivel até três dias antes da data agendada.
Ex.: Agendo o exame para dia 20/03/2008 então somente posso cancelar esse exame até o dia 17/03/2008, porém tem que ter cuidado com o fuso horário, pois não é baseado no horário de Brasília.
O exame:
Antes de iniciar o exame real, a Sun vem com umas 10 perguntas apenas para saber o nível dos candidatos do exame. Porém como há humores de “força maior” sobre esse mundo, dizem que não recomendado marcar a opção “Expert”. Então marquei beginner e não é necessário ler o que está perguntando não, assim não perde tempo, apesar que dizem que o tempo nessa parte não conta, mais no momento não prestei atenção.
Fase 2: As primeiras questões. A Sun durante todo o tempo vai tentar tirar sua atenção, como por exemplo:
protected class Teste1{
int z=10;
public static void main(String ars[]){
int z=10;
System.out.println(z);
}}
A – Compila e imprime 10
B – Não compila por que mudou o nome de “args”
C – Lança uma exceção NullPointerException
D – Não compila
A resposta para essa questão é letra D. Devido o modificador protected não ser um modificador válido para classe pai.
O que é mais cobrado no exame?
Percebi que o exame é bem focado nos seguintes objetivos: fundamentos e OO. Porém entender OO de forma fluente é uma boa garantia de se passar no exame, mesmo que o programador não seja um expert em API, threads etc.
Como são cobrados os novos recursos Java 5?
Os novos recursos Java 5 são cobrados a todo momento. Como as regras de Wrappers, generics, var-args as novas api. No meu exame 30% das questões ficou para esse aspecto. O exame está bem direto ao objetivo: “de ficar longe dos bits e mais próximo das Api.”
E o tempo é suficiente?
Sim. Porém o candidato deve estar bem preparado para o exame. Caso contrário o tempo se esgota e o candidato vai marcar a última questão restando apenas 5 minutos . E isso aumenta o risco de ver a mensagem “fail”.
Estilo das questões do exame: total 72 questões
Múltipla escolha: é onde tem mais pegadinhas muita atenção a elas e desconfie daquelas que as respostas aparentam ser obvias. Antes de responder análise sempre as respostas e o código. E veja se há quebra das regras de fundamentos, OO antes de marcar a opção que demonstra ser a mais obvia.
Drop: dizem por ai que são as questões mais complicadas no exame, porém em minha opinião considero um “certo mito”, pois é uma das questões que o candidato tem certeza que uma das opções dadas tem que ser preenchido nas lacunas em branco e que o código ali está correto. Não há pegadinhas nessas questões. Porém exige que o futuro programador tenha praticado e muito durante a fase de preparação, já que esse tipo de questão está bem próximo das questões mais praticas.
Mais de uma opção correta/errada: Essas questões também tem pegadinhas como as de múltipla escolha. Porém a diferença aqui que o exame informa quantas opções você deve marcar. Se o exame mencionar duas corretas/erradas, localize as duas respostas.
Táctica de ser um bom administrador de tempo no exame
– Primeiro fazer todas as questões do exame normalmente, quando a questão for muito longa e tiver uma sintaxe com mais de 30 linhas marque para revisar. As drop não faça logo de cara, apenas abra a questão olhe as opções anote o número da questão e do lado coloque a resposta que achou válida. (essa questão consome muito tempo)
– Após ter feito todas as questões simples, você vai estar no final do exame ele vai ti informar que algumas questões não foram respondidas, ou seja, ficou em branco. Claro que você sabe que são as de drop ( no meu caso somente apareceu 10 questoes desse tipo) então vá fazê-la porém agora com mais calma e nessa altura sua ansiedade de saber quais as próximas questões não existe mais.
– Agora resta as questões marcadas para revisar e analisar. Tinha questão com código com 45 linhas.
– Pronto agora vamos estar na casa de +- 1:20h para terminar o exame então pode dar uma relaxada nesse momento(se espreguiçar, beber uma água). Em seguida começe a fazer o simulado novamente revisando da primeira questão e perguntando por que? As outras alternativas não são verdadeiras? Exceto aquelas que estavam claramente que não compilava (onde você já identificou isso na primeira fase).
Terminando isso devem faltar uns 20 minutos para o final do exame. Ai você decide se vai finalizar o exame ou revisar mais uma questao. No meu caso finalizei pois começei a sentir uma leve dor de cabeça.
– Na revisão é normal identificar às pegadinhas, e as possíveis questões que você estaria perdendo, por uma pequena falta de atenção.
– Não revise as questões de drop, se tentar o exame vai apagar a sua resposta anterior.Porém se tentar o exame emiti uma mensagem a respeito. Esse foi um dos motivos que deixei por ultimo as de drop.
Tempo nas questões:
Não demore mais de 3min em uma questão seja ela qual for. Assim você ganha tempo na revisão.
Conclusão:
Antes do exame procure relaxar e não pegar no livro de forma do tipo “querendo aprender”. Apenas leia resumos, e pegando um papel em branco e anotando todas as regras que surgir em sua mente sobre cada assunto.
Procure também dormir bem antes do exame para não chegar com o corpo muito cansado e o dia que escolher também é essencial não faça o exame em um dia que você está muito cansado tipo uma sexta-feira seu corpo está pedindo o final de semana. No meu caso escolhi s segunda-feira, pois começo a semana com bastante energia.
No dia do exame procure chegar 30min antes e relaxar o máximo possível, converse com a secretaria do centro autorizado, ouça uma musica (para aqueles que têm mp3/mp4). E depois é partir para a sala de justiça.
Falow! Abraços a todos e espero que tenham gostado.
Que show Camilo, estou gostando do blog, atualizado bons assuntos.
Very good =)
Parábens Camilo pela sua iniciativa…
continue postando no blog…
abs
Muito bom ! Tirei recentementea SCJP e estou estudando para SCWCD, estoui esperando para ter mais segurança em todo assunto pois a porcentagem é consideravelmente mais alta que a da SCJP. Porém eu recomendo fazer os exames em inglês, pois o código traduzido é meio incomodo.
Parabéns =)
Opa! Valeu Galera!! Toda Segunda e Quinta o blog será atualizado!!!
O material é bacana, vou aproveitar muitas sugestões.
Obrigadopor compartilhar.
valeeeeu
Salve Camilo,
qual dos dois livros vc indica: Guia Certificação Java – Exame 310-055 ou Certificação Java 5 ??? ou ambos ?!
nao sei se faço um curso na Squadra ou compro ambos e estudo por conta própria
grande abraço
opa! Renato,
bom sao livros com objetivos diferentes:
O certificacao java 5 – tem bastante simulados para vc fazer e uns resumos no final de cada capitulo, porem sao resumos ao pe da letra mesmo.
E o 310-055 – eh com o objetivo de ensinar realmente o conteudo da prova e testar com os simulado no final de cada capitulo.
Somente com o livro da kathy vc consegue fazer a prova, mas se puder compre o outro livro. Eu comprei pq sempre q estava com tempo livre fazia as questoes, tipo no onibus ia respondendo e talz.. qto mais simulados fizer melhor. Agora um detalhe o livro certificacao java 5 muitas questoes vieram do whilabs, sun etc. tem alguns erros la de traducao, mais besteira. Porem o autor diz que é dele :S
Bom dia Camilo,
Já estou estudando faz um tempo, gostaria de saber o que você me aconselha de simulado para o exame.
Olá Camilo,
gostei muito do post, parece que cada vez mais que leio sobre o assunto fico mais assustado… mais estou seguro de que vou conseguir. Comecei a estudar tem 3 semanas e estou me baseando no livro de Kathy.
Estou estudando pelo livro em inglês, como não sou um expert em inglês ainda estou perdendo um pouco de tempo. Decidi comprar o livro traduzido, porem li em alguns forums e percebi que existe algumas resistências pelo pessoal em estudar por ele. Gostaria de saber o que você acha?
Parabéns pelo seu trabalho neste blog!